    Desert Sun Stadium is a converted soccer-specific stadium in Yuma, Arizona, originally built for baseball. It was the spring training home of the San Diego Padres from 1970 through 1993, the North American League 's Yuma Scorpions minor league baseball team, the Arizona Winter League , and the Arizona Summer League .
